Advanced Manufacturing Institute Hires Network Specialist

(Manhattan, Kan. October 2, 2007) – David Williams has accepted the position of network specialist for the Advanced Manufacturing Institute at Kansas State University. Williams will be responsible for providing network and server support, in addition to serving as a technical resource on industrial projects.

In this role, Williams will maintain and enhance AMI’s network, intranet and Web site.

Williams earned associate degrees in both electronic engineering technology and computer engineering technology from Kansas State University at Salina. He is also a Microsoft certified professional. Williams previously provided network support, disaster recovery and served as project team leader for Lextron Information Systems in Garden City, Kan.

“David’s extensive training and experience in software, hardware and networking across multiple platforms makes him a great fit for AMI.” said Brad Kramer, director of the Advanced Manufacturing Institute, “We are delighted to have David on our team.”
